EXECUTIVE SUMMARY

PURPOSE:
To design and develop a robust database for Scansys Inc that is customized and tailored
to their specific needs and industry.

BACKGOUND:
Scansys Inc., based in Los Angeles, California has been providing surveillance systems
throughout the United States, Canada, Mexico and Puerto Rico since 1999. Its primary
source of goods is CNB Technologies Inc; a Korean based company with whom Scansys
has had a long standing business relationship.
Over the years, Scansys has established itself as one of the leading providers of
surveillance systems within the entertainment industry. The primary contact for the
project at hand will be Steven Sung, Director of Sales Marketing.

PROBLEM:
At present time, Scansys Inc Database Management System (DMS) is an ‘off-the-shelf’
commercially available product. Although at the time of purchase the system was
assessed to meet the current needs for the company, as the years have passed and the
company along its needs have grown the current DBS is no longer capable of meeting the
requirements. Among the major drawbacks of the current system are:

• Employee Profiling:
The current system does not allow the entry of employee detailed
information, and only allows the entry of ‘initials’ per each employee.
As sales increase, Scansys has decided to implement a bonus/commission
system as a means to boost employee morale. However, the inability of
being able to identify each individual employee negates such
implementation.

• Bonus/Commission:
The current DMS does not have a module to create bonuses/commissions
based on any given set parameters (ex. 10% per $1000.00 Sale).
Consequently, such computation that it be done manually for each sales-
agent; a task that is both time and cost inefficient.

• Reports:
The present DBS does not have the ability to generate any type of reports.

PROJECT OBJECTIVE AND SCOPE:


The resulting product will allow Scansys Inc to populate its database with detailed
information on the following key areas:

• Employee
• Customers and Customer’s Credit Card(s) Information
• Vendors
• Inventory with Pricing Information

In addition, the designed database will have the ability to track all sales for the company
as well as track all sales per agent. In turn, this will enable Scansys Inc to implement a
bonus/commission system built into the database based on a set of given parameters.
